Transaction 62ee01c109cd75e5002edb43d6278e64ee2c4d22182d42e67681b27e2f113150

1 Input
2 Outputs
  • 62ee01c109cd75e5002edb43d6278e64ee2c4d22182d42e67681b27e2f113150:0
  • value  53335597933
    address  2N6XJAJW4r15kMY8cCMLbGw4j8nLDQ4FyDa
  • 62ee01c109cd75e5002edb43d6278e64ee2c4d22182d42e67681b27e2f113150:1
  • value  1935061
    address  2NGXrYd29QnQRxJFWurgtiNs9r7wFSNNDAJ